Her beige sweater
had a small wrinkle over her savory skin

She used to cry under the river
For only the trees could bring the shower of tears under a heavy silence

She had a soft stroke when she touched the branches of the forest
And only then did it tie the woods together
with their soft crawl of a gentle, Tennessee wind

Dark,
Her facial features were quiet
Rather studious of the way
A woman lost her gentle walk
By the mirror of the light

They tried her eyes under a soft silhouette
that centered off the living room wall
where she brought her own freckles to the sunrise that day

Her looks paved the night for silence
to reach the golden gates of the even horizons
sunrise came
as she woke
Along the cobbled road
with each eyelash more becoming than the next
a sunrise radiant of the mornings quiet stroke
